Major necessities to sustain human progress are an adequate source of energy. Currently the sources of energy such as combustion of coal, natural gas and oil will last quite a long but will eventually run out or become harmful in tens or hundreds of years. A new focus on global warming which most researchers say is caused due to gases released by the combustion of fossil fuels has brought coal, gas and oil-fired generation under scrutiny. The reducing stocks of bio-fuels and the fact that nuclear energy doesn’t put greenhouse gases into the atmosphere have initiated the process of sustained research for using nuclear energy to meet the manifold demands of various countries.

Unfortunately several incidents like the Chernobyl disaster in 1986 and The three mile land disaster in 1979 has changed the attitude of people towards this form of energy and the labor shortage in this industry is alarming. In U.S half of the industry’s employees are above 45, while less than 6% of the employees are below 32.Given that U.S’s nuclear power stations together generate 25% of the country’s electricity’s needs, what is going to happen if these industries shut. India right now is obtaining only 4 percent of its electricity from nuclear power.The nuclear energy by 2050 is expected to reach 25 percent.All this has resulted in creating a huge scope for nuclear jobs.

Looking into the future the prospects are really encouraging.Generation lV launched by the U.S is an international intiative to carry out research into new nuclear power stations.These projects are expected to be finished by 2030.Countries such as Argentina, France, Brazil, Canada, Japan, North korea,South korea and Switzerland are a part of this initiative.U.S is also exploring ways they can associate with India which is home to nearly one-third of thorium reserves and copious accomplished work force.

To pursue a career in nuclear science an engineering student can go for programs like Masters in nuclear engineering and PhD. The engineers should also have knowledge about various environmental, economic and social issues. Nuclear engineers have many responsibilities to carry out such as nuclear plant design,construct and operate nuclear plants, generate nuclear power,thrust nuclear submarines,control space system, handling nuclear fuels, safely disposal radioactive wastes, using radioactive isotopes for medicinal purposes.
